H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E T.SUNIL CHOWDARY WRIT PETITION No.24468 OF 2016 ORDER:

This writ petition is filed under Article 226 of the Constitution of India seeking a writ of Mandamus declaring the action of the respondents 2 and 3 and their subordinates in trying to dispossess the petitioner from the land admeasuring Ac.2.091⁄2 guntas in Sy.No.160/EE and 161/A/5 situated at Rejarla Revenue Village, Thallada Mandal of Khammam District, without issuing any notice and without initiating land acquisition proceedings and also trying to close the well and bore-well as illegal and arbitrary and consequently direct the respondents and their staff not to interfere with the possession of the petitioner in any manner.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ned Assistant Government Pleader for Irrigation.

The contention of the learned counsel for the petitioner is that the petitioner is the owner of the land in an extent of Ac.2.091⁄2 guntas in Sy.No.160/EE and 161/A/5 situated at Rejarla Revenue Village, Thallada Mandal of Khammam District. The petitioner herein dug a bore-well in the said land for the purpose of cultivation of his land.

The contention of the learned Assistant Government Pleader for irrigation is that the petitioner in violation of Section 43 of A.P. (Telangana Area) Irrigation Act, 1357 fasli dug the bore-well. The fact remains that the petitioner has been in possession and enjoyment of an extent of Ac.2.091⁄2 cents along with borewell. If at all the petitioner dug the well in violation of the

provisions of the Act, the respondents are at liberty to take appropriate action. The respondents have no right whatsoever to close the well of the petitioner without following due procedure. Having regard to the facts and circumstances of the case, the respondents 1 to 3 are hereby directed not to take possession of the land of the petitioner or close the well of the petitioner without following due procedure.

With the above direction, the writ petition is disposed of. As a sequel, miscellaneous petitions pending, if any, in this writ petition shall stand closed.
